๐ What are Whole Number Word Problems?
Whole number word problems are math questions presented as stories or scenarios where you need to use addition, subtraction, multiplication, or division (or a combination of these!) to find the answer. They involve only whole numbers (no fractions or decimals!).

๐ Key Principles for Solving Word Problems
- ๐ Read Carefully: Understand what the problem is asking. Read it more than once!
- ๐ Identify Key Information: What numbers and units are given? What are you trying to find?
- โ Choose the Operation: Decide whether to add, subtract, multiply, or divide (or a combination). Look for keywords!
- โ Solve the Problem: Perform the calculation accurately.
- โ Check Your Answer: Does the answer make sense in the context of the problem?
- โ๏ธ Write the Answer: Include the correct units (e.g., apples, meters, dollars).
โ Keywords for Addition
- โ Sum
- ๐ก Total
- โจ In all
- ๐ฑ Combined
- ๐ Increase
โ Keywords for Subtraction
- โ Difference
- ๐ Left
- ๐ Fewer
- ๐๏ธ Removed
- ๐ค How many more
โ๏ธ Keywords for Multiplication
- โ๏ธ Product
- ๐ฆ Times
- ๐ฏ Multiplied by
- ๐งฑ Of
- ๐ Area
โ Keywords for Division
- โ Quotient
- ๐ Divided by
- ๐ฐ Shared equally
- ๐งโ๐คโ๐ง Split
- ๐งบ Each
๐ Real-World Examples
Example 1: Addition
Sarah has 15 apples, and John has 12 apples. How many apples do they have in all?
Solution: $15 + 12 = 27$ apples
Example 2: Subtraction
A baker made 36 cookies and sold 21 of them. How many cookies are left?
Solution: $36 - 21 = 15$ cookies
Example 3: Multiplication
A classroom has 5 rows of desks, and each row has 6 desks. How many desks are there in total?
Solution: $5 \times 6 = 30$ desks
Example 4: Division
There are 24 students in a class, and they need to be divided into 4 equal groups. How many students will be in each group?
Solution: $24 \div 4 = 6$ students
Example 5: Multi-Step Problem
A store sells pencils for $2 each and erasers for $1 each. Mary buys 3 pencils and 2 erasers. How much does she spend in total?
Solution: Cost of pencils: $3 \times 2 = $6$. Cost of erasers: $2 \times 1 = $2$. Total cost: $6 + 2 = $8$
๐ก Tips for Success
- ๐จ Draw a Picture: Visualizing the problem can help you understand it better.
- โ๏ธ Write Down What You Know: List the given information and what you need to find.
- ๐งฉ Break It Down: If the problem seems complicated, break it down into smaller steps.
- ๐ฌ Talk It Out: Explain the problem to someone else. This can help you clarify your thinking.
- ๐ช Practice, Practice, Practice: The more you practice, the better you'll become at solving word problems!
